Traduzione e definizione
(a) blunt (person): (una persona) brusca, schietta
(a) blunt (knife): (un coltello) smussato
(Be) blunt!: (sii) schietto!

This is incorrect. "Blunt" is not synonymous with "impolite". An "impolite (person)" is rude or offensive. Example: French waiters are very impolite, generally speaking.
This is incorrect. "To interrupt (someone)" is to is to "cut" or break into their speech.
This is incorrect. "Blunt" is not synonymous with "brief". A "brief (presentation)" is short, or concise.
This is the correct answer. If someone is "blunt", they are "frank" or "direct" in their manner of speech. Example: "My boss can be very blunt and he told me immediately that he hated my presentation".
